“I Told You So” Performed by Lauren Alaina and Scotty McCreery on American Idol’s Top 11 Results

The performance of “I Told You So” by Lauren Alaina and Scotty McCreery on American Idol’s Top 11 Results show stands out as a seminal moment that encapsulated the essence of country music blended with youthful exuberance. The interaction between the two contestants not only demonstrated their individual capabilities but also elevated the song into an exploration of shared emotions and experiences, a hallmark of compelling duets.

Originally penned by the iconic Randy Travis, “I Told You So” tells a poignant story of regret and unrequited love, encapsulated in poetic lyrics that resonate with many. Travis’s original version remains a benchmark for emotive storytelling in country music, and the song has been covered by various artists over the years, but Alaina and McCreery’s interpretation injected new life into the classic, making it relevant for a new generation of listeners. Their approach retained the song’s original sentiment while layering it with youthful perspectives and raw emotion.

Lauren Alaina’s artistic journey began long before her time on American Idol. Drawing from her Southern roots, she often infuses her music with personal experiences and heartfelt storytelling, which resonates deeply with her audience. From an early age, Alaina exhibited a natural affinity for music, participating in various local competitions and developing her vocal prowess. Her impressive range and vocal agility became apparent as she moved further into her career, culminating in her outstanding performance on American Idol, where she was recognized not just for her singing ability but her ability to connect with the audience.

Scotty McCreery’s path to musical stardom paralleled Alaina’s, characterized by a similar dedication to craft and an undeniable talent. His deep, soulful voice has a timeless quality that pays homage to the traditional roots of country music while also appealing to contemporary audiences. Winning American Idol solidified his place in the music industry, and he has since carved out a niche as a respected artist known for compelling lyrics that often reflect his own life’s journey.

When Alaina and McCreery stepped onto the American Idol stage together, it showcased a harmonious blend of their distinct vocal styles. Their chemistry was palpable, and the audience could sense the genuine respect they had for one another as artists and friends. Each note they sang felt interwoven with an unspoken understanding and camaraderie. Their voices complemented each other beautifully, Alaina’s soaring range intertwining seamlessly with McCreery’s smooth baritone, creating a sound that was rich and full.

The emotional depth conveyed in their performance transformed “I Told You So” into a moving portrayal of a shared narrative rather than individual experiences. This understanding of vulnerability comes from their collective journey through the highs and lows of competition, which allowed them to evoke authentic emotions that resonated with the viewers and judges alike. They made the audience feel every ounce of longing and sincerity woven into the song, a difficult task that speaks to their mature artistry despite their young ages.

In the arrangement of their duet, simplicity was key. The instrumentation—a gentle backdrop of acoustic guitars and light percussion—allowed the focus to remain solely on their vocal prowess. This choice served to amplify the emotional intensity of the performance, showing that sometimes less is more, particularly in a genre that thrives on sincerity and raw emotion. The arrangement allowed the message of the song to come through without any distractions, inviting listeners to feel and reflect alongside the performers.
